Trip Overview

The drive from Seaford, NY to Staten Island, NY covers 43.3 miles and takes about 1h 10m behind the wheel. This route is realistic as a one-day drive if you keep your stops efficient.

The route leans on Belt Parkway, Sunrise Highway, Staten Island Expressway for much of the mileage, and the overall profile is mixed drive. The longest uninterrupted segment is about 19 miles on Belt Parkway. At current regular gas prices, budget about $7.05 one way before food or hotel costs.
